Here Come the Brides Luncheon
Weslaco Museum 500 South Texas Blvd., WeslacoThe Weslaco Museum hosts the annual “Here Come the Brides Luncheon” presented by The Museum Guild on June 25. The luncheon will feature a presentation by Joe Vidales, discussing wedding styles through the years. Purchase tickets for $25 at the museum or from guild members.

Building ‘N’ BBQ
Smokin' Moon BBQ 617 W Polk Ave., PharrBuilding 'N' BBQ on June 23 helps disseminate information and educate local contractors on the upcoming construction opportunities on the $92-million UT Health RGV Cancer and Surgery Center going up on the corner of North Jackson Road and East Pecan Blvd./495. This is an opportunity to meet the prime contractor Vaughn Construction and network with project management. This event is open to the community. Register online.
